  • The "Cadastre GSM" or "Cadastre hertzien" is integrated into the national geoportal of the Grand Duchy of Luxembourg (direct URL: https://map.geoportail.lu/theme/cadastre_hertzien?version=3&zoom=8&X=772788&Y=6379807&lang=fr&layers=811-802-801&opacities=1-1-1&bgLayer=basemap_2015_globall). It allows anyone wishing to take note of the location and technical characteristics of the mobile phone antennas.

  • A medium combustion plant is any technical device with a rated thermal input of 1 MW or more and less than 50 MW in which combustible products are oxidised in order to use the heat thus produced, such as combustion plants, engines and gas turbines. All medium combustion installations must be registered with the Environmental Administration, which keeps a public register with information on each installation. The operating conditions and the obligations of the operators of these installations are laid down in the Grand-Ducal Regulation of 24 April 2018 on the limitation of emissions from medium combustion installations.

  • The present location map shows the distribution of wind turbines authorized by the Minister of the Environment under the legislation on classified establishments. Depending on the data availability, information on the installed power, hub height and diameter of the propeller can be consulted. "Autorisé" is the project of a wind turbine that has been authorized under the legislation on classified establishments, while "existant" is a wind turbine built by the constructor and according to the implementation report. It should be noted that the coordinates of existing wind turbines listed in the authorization files do not always correspond exactly to the coordinates of the actual locations of the wind turbines after construction, and may vary slightly depending on the construction. Where applicable, the coordinates of wind turbines validated by an official surveyor are indicated by an attribute.

  • The relatively quiet urban oases include public green areas and open spaces with a high quality of living space and an appropriate design as compensation areas within walking distance of residential and work locations. Due to their inner-city location, they do not, or do not completely, meet the above-mentioned criteria of a quiet area, e. g. by showing an increased noise level or being significantly lower. However, the urban planning context of the areas has noise-reducing properties, which lead to the fact that the urban oases in their core areas are considerably calmer than their surroundings. These areas make it possible, for example, to take short walks for those seeking peace and quietness in the immediate vicinity of their homes or workplaces.
